These are my 39th birthday nails:) A simple design, using black gel paint, gold foil and custom made rhinestones with gel and glitter. And of course, my favorite color.. blue:)

I have tried a few gel paints and foils for this technique, but so far, the combination of these products by the local store "star-nails.gr" is the best. I cured the paint gel for 2 minutes and applied the foil. It worked like a charm..

Mind you, my white french nails are done with soak off gel polish, for two reasons. First, because I wanted to finish before my birthday and couldn't wait for normal polish to dry. Second, because if the polish is not dry 100%, it may pick some foil, too, and it would be more difficult to remove. I am not giving soak off directions, those of you who use shellac type polishes know all the steps to it, so I am focusing on the design.

Use a topcoat that will nor wrinkle your foil. I heard a few good things about aqua base by Nfuoh, but for me it dries slowly.. Also, youtuber Mariepassionnails used an Nfuoh "Shine" topcoat on her liquid stone nailart, and had very good results. I have tried cnd shellac topcoat over polish before, and I had no problems. I can't say it extended the wear, because these few times I didn't keep the nailart long enough, I just wanted something to cover foil, dry fast and remove easily (cnd shellac doesn't require buffing the surface before you soak it off). Nubar also has a uv topcoat in pink bottle, I have tried it over polish, and it works fine, so you never know... It may not be the right thing to do, but If you can afford the experiment, try using a soak off topcoat whenever you use foil, even on top of normal nail polish.
